What Is a Remote Pharmacist?

Remote pharmacists work primarily from home or another location outside of the office or health care facility. Similar to pharmacists who work in hospitals and commercial pharmacies, remote pharmacists handle prescriptions and may answer questions about drug interactions, but they are typically consultants for hospitals and clinics or handle prescriptions for mail order drug companies, short- and long-term care facilities, and other similar businesses. Remote pharmacists monitor the process of filling prescriptions for their company; they oversee the accurate entry of prescribed medications into the system and ensure the orders are filled efficiently. Remote pharmacists may need to visit the office occasionally, but they do the majority of their administrative work remotely. They usually do not have a lot of direct interaction with patients.

How does a remote pharmacist typically communicate and collaborate with healthcare teams and patients?

Remote pharmacists rely on secure digital platforms, such as telehealth software, electronic health records, and email, to communicate with physicians, nurses, and patients. Collaboration often involves reviewing prescriptions, providing medication counseling, and participating in virtual care team meetings. While the lack of in-person interaction can be a challenge, effective communication skills and familiarity with telepharmacy tools are essential for success. Remote pharmacists also play a pivotal role in ensuring patient safety by addressing medication-related questions and resolving issues promptly.

Remote Prior Authorization Pharmacist - Work From Home in Managed Care
A confidential managed care organization is seeking a motivated Remote Prior Authorization Pharmacist to evaluate prescription requests, ensure medical necessity, and improve patient access to safe and effective therapies. This work-from-home position is ideal for pharmacists who want to transition out of retail or hospital settings while building expertise in managed care.
Key Responsibilities

  • Review prior authorization requests for accuracy, appropriateness, and clinical necessity.
  • Apply plan criteria, evidence-based guidelines, and regulatory standards to determinations.
  • Communicate approval/denial decisions clearly to providers and patients.
  • Collaborate with physicians, nurses, and medical directors on complex cases.
  • Document outcomes in compliance with health plan policies and CMS/state regulations.
  • Support process improvements to streamline workflow and turnaround times.


What You'll Bring

  • Education: Doctor of Pharmacy (PharmD) or Bachelor of Pharmacy degree.
  • Licensure: Active and unrestricted pharmacist license in the U.S.
  • Experience: Prior authorization, utilization management, or managed care preferred - retail or hospital pharmacists with strong clinical judgment are encouraged to apply.
  • Skills: Excellent clinical review, documentation, and communication skills.
